About Chamaneru Village
Chamaneru is a village in Peddapanjani tehsil in district of Chittoor, Andhra Pradesh,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Chamaneru was 1,133 which includes 566 males and 567 females. Chamaneru covers 432 ha area. Pincode of Chamaneru is 517432.
